Output 573e528eebcdfbb2df11d347cac90f88d2001f31ba986d39de368deeebfaca41:15

value
366072448
script pubkey
OP_0 OP_PUSHBYTES_20 9d508b420520fb4dabe5ba14ad654e2c5146aa0a
address
bc1qn4ggkss9yra5m2l9hg226e2w93g5d2s22jlq78
transaction
573e528eebcdfbb2df11d347cac90f88d2001f31ba986d39de368deeebfaca41
confirmations
141707
spent
true